Chelsea striker Olivier Giroud has arrived in Milan ahead of his proposed move to AC Milan this summer. Giroud, 34, was spotted in Italy ahead of his medical checks which are expected to be taking place at the Milanello training ground on Friday. The 34-year-old will sign a two-year contract with Stefano Poli’s side, in a deal which will cost the Rossoneri a total of €2 million (£1.7 million). €1 million (£850,000) directly to Chelsea, plus another €1m (£850,000) in add-ons. Speaking in February,

Thomas Tuchel said: “If you see him on a daily basis, you cannot be surprised. He is totally fit, his body is in shape and his physicality is on top level. Mentally I have really the feeling he enjoys every day being a professional soccer player on this level and this is the level he needs to be. He trains like a 20-year-old, like a 24-year-old. He is a guy who has a good mixture of serious and joy in training. He is always positive and it is a big factor for the group. He starts, when he comes from the bench, he has all these qualities and it is good like this.”
